The table below prov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in the East of England with a requirement for knowledge and experience of Databricks products and/or services.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Databricks over the 6 months to 26 April 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

The figures below represent the IT labour market in general and are not representative of salaries within Databricks.

6 months to
26 Apr 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 199 223 240
Rank change year-on-year +24 +17 -52
Permanent jobs citing Databricks 25 25 33
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in the East of England 0.41% 0.45% 0.52%
As % of the Vendors category 1.17% 0.99% 1.33%
Number of salaries quoted 17 16 3
10th Percentile £58,750 £51,875 £51,000
25th Percentile £70,000 £54,688 £54,375
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£85,000 £62,500 £60,000
Median % change year-on-year +36.00% +4.17% +4.35%
75th Percentile £112,500 £87,500 £65,000
90th Percentile £118,750 £89,375 £68,000
England median annual salary £80,000 £80,000 £72,500
% change year-on-year - +10.34% +3.57%
